On 8/3/2018 2:36 PM, Adrien Mazarguil wrote:
> This is a follow up to the "Flow API helpers enhancements" series submitted
> almost a year ago [1]. The new title is due to the reduced scope of this
> version.
> 
> rte_flow_conv() is a flexible replacement to rte_flow_copy(), itself a
> temporary solution pending something better [2]. It replaces a lot of
> duplicated code found in testpmd and removes some of the maintenance burden
> that developers tend to forget (me included) when modifying pattern
> item or actions (updating app/test-pmd/config.c to be clear).
> 
> This series was unearthed in order to complete the implementation of
> RTE_FLOW_ACTION_TYPE_ENCAP_(VXLAN|NVGRE) in testpmd [3] without having to
> duplicate existing code once again.

Causing build error for arm, it looks like related to rte_memcpy macro:

.../lib/librte_ethdev/rte_flow.c: In function ‘rte_flow_conv_item_spec’:
.../lib/librte_ethdev/rte_flow.c:373:58: error: macro "rte_memcpy" passed 9
arguments, but takes just 3
       (size > sizeof(*dst.raw) ? sizeof(*dst.raw) : size));
